Output 7bcacb5059d7726697a903875068014ddddf88fe59f262fc1350ee719b59c931:42

value
920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826aa186a5a2f56c9ab713c8e13075abf7953792 OP_EQUAL
address
3DabWL8u5Dv6B9oKtZUyNkvZ3GLPCwVyxV
transaction
7bcacb5059d7726697a903875068014ddddf88fe59f262fc1350ee719b59c931
spent
true